Like a lot of my recipes, this one is pretty easy to adapt to your own tastes….I added 1/4 cup mashed bananas in place of the oil. Feel free to experiment!
BAKED OATMEAL
(serves 4)
INGREDIENTS:
1 egg slightly beaten
1 1/2 cups regular or steel cut oats
1/3 cup sugar
1/2 cup fat free milk
3 T canola oil
1/4 chopped nuts (any kind)
1/4 cup raisins or any dried fruit chopped into raisin-sized bits
1 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p salt
1/2 tsp cinnamon
DIRECTIONS:
Pre-heat oven to 350 degrees. Combine all ingredients in a bowl. Spray 8 inch square baking dish with cooking oil spray (or use individual ramekins, sprayed). Pour combined ingredients into prepared pan and press down slightly.
Bake for 25 minutes. Cool for 15 minutes, then cut into squares. Serve with vanilla yogurt on top for an extra treat!
